The road to recovery

Commercial vehicle leasing is growing in popularity as companies find ways to reduce capital costs, says Simon Cook

With the general economic outlook remaining extremely difficult, it might come as a surprise to hear that commercial vehicle sales are booming. After several years in the doldrums, total new van and truck sales are on the rise – being up by around 20% in 2011 according to the Society of Motor Manufacturers and Traders.
